Marty Phelan is a Realtor with D'Aprile Properties in Chicago, specializing in buyer & seller representation, Short Sales, & Foreclosure Prevention.
Full service real estate brokerage and representation for buyers and sellers in the Chicago-Metro area. Areas of specialization include the West Loop, Bucktown, Millenium Park, South Loop/Museum Park, Wicker Park, Lakeview, Lincoln Park, Gold Coast, Streeterville, Lincoln Square, and Andersonville.
